Here are some tips on how to get the look:
- Stick to two or three colors to pull this look off; any more can get overwhelming and defeat the entire look.
- This trend can work using all shades of color including brights, bolds and pastels. Neutrals are huge with this look as well and can complement a bright, bold color. This is seen in the clutch above from Francesca’s.
